List the levels of organization within environments. (Community, species, habitat, ecosystem, population)

Answer:

population → community → ecosystem → biosphere

"Habitat" doesn't quite fit in this list. "Species" likewise doesn't fit well, but I suppose it could go at the start of the list.

Species: members of the same, well, species. Homo sapiens, for example; a group of humans is a species.

Population: similar to species, but used to describe an individual group of organisms. Like if there are 30 dogs in my house, that's a population of 30, though the species probably is made up of thousands.

Community: a group of biotic factors (remember, living, not nonliving) in the same space.

Ecosystem: a combination of all those biotic factors, plus abiotic factors like rocks, wind, sun, et cetera

Biosphere: the whole Earth.
